Output 6051903684ed6085e0dae990a67158b8f5d2ba78c2b66a9f48d7ba5e30f15613:5

value
20989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d9bdf4563fe09d475c657f52d8a75b6628ebfd2 OP_EQUAL
address
3G4Njr9T4RDdkPiTNUqNhVswcAx26tGpN3
transaction
6051903684ed6085e0dae990a67158b8f5d2ba78c2b66a9f48d7ba5e30f15613
spent
true